Output 28ef2bb4c3e1e95b1bbfa5b33fa554f00a574c89be26378001912196049aa5fa:4

value
136938
script pubkey
OP_0 OP_PUSHBYTES_20 cbd5a8956c06c62b47075f96441ed1de2f1ad1a0
address
bc1qe02639tvqmrzk3c8t7tyg8k3mch345dq30kauw
transaction
28ef2bb4c3e1e95b1bbfa5b33fa554f00a574c89be26378001912196049aa5fa
confirmations
137139
spent
true